我在使用“推文”按钮时遇到问题。这是 Twitter 提供的代码:
<a href="https://twitter.com/share" class="twitter-share-button">Tweet</a>
<script>!function(d,s,id){var js,fjs=d.getElementsByTagName(s)[0];if(!d.getElementById(id)){js=d.createElement(s);js.id=id;js.src="//platform.twitter.com/widgets.js";fjs.parentNode.insertBefore(js,fjs);}}(document,"script","twitter-wjs");</script>
我正在将其加载到页面上弹出的模式中。第一次加载时效果很好,但如果有人关闭模式并重新打开它,它就不会再加载按钮。
您可以尝试将 Twitter 的 widgets.js 添加为常规脚本,包含在您的<head>
,然后一旦你渲染了你的模态,你就可以调用
twttr.widgets.load();
这应该刷新它找到的所有 Twitter 按钮。
这意味着您不需要提供的代码片段中的块,您的推文按钮只是以下形式
<a href="https://twitter.com/share" class="twitter-share-button">Tweet</a>
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)